    How Bitcoin ETFs Are Changing Institutions’ Appetite for Crypto

    Bloomberg ETF analyst Eric Balchunas on Tuesday argued that spot Bitcoin(<a href="https://xpertsstudio.com/sec-chair-unveils-push-to-reshore-crypto-innovation/” title=”SEC chair unveils push to reshore crypto innovation”>CRYPTO: BTC) ETFs have solved one of the asset’s biggest adoption problems by increasingly embedding the asset in traditional investment portfolios.

    Why ETF Inflows Matter

    BlackRock(NYSE:BLK) continues to dominate Bitcoin ETF inflows, with total assets across the products nearing $100 billion in August.

    Balchunas said Tuesday that BlackRock’s iShares Bitcoin Trust(NASDAQ:IBIT) remains the category’s standout product, but noted that inflows are increasingly broad-based across multiple issuers.

    “When you see all of them taking money, then you know people are into Bitcoin,” he told Scott Melker in an interview.

    Balchunas estimates only a small portion of IBIT flows, potentially around 2% to 3%, comes from investors converting Bitcoin held directly into ETF shares.

    Balchunas also highlighted that IBIT has slightly outperformed Vanguard’s S&P 500 ETF since its launch despite Bitcoin prices suffering a roughly 50% drawdown along the way.

    BTC Has Now a Durable Bid

    Balchunas said ETFs have effectively fixed Bitcoin’s intermediary problem as they grant access to investors through the same infrastructure they already use for stocks and bonds. That could make flows stickier.

    Balchunas pointed to TradFi ETF investors as generally long-term oriented attracting capital even during major stock-market declines.

    For Bitcoin, that creates a potentially more durable institutional and wealth-management bid than the market had in earlier cycles.

    For a traditional portfolio, Balchunas sees roughly a 3% BTC allocation as a potential “sweet spot,” large enough to matter if Bitcoin appreciates sharply but small enough to limit damage from another severe drawdown.

    The Debasement Trade Remains Key

    Balchunas said Bitcoin’s underlying investment case still matters more than the ETF structure itself.

    He described Bitcoin’s two core attributes as debasement resistance and censorship resistance wherein the former is the stronger Wall Street narrative.

    Growing government debt, intervention in bond markets and persistent inflation concerns are reinforcing BTC’s appeal as an alternative store of value alongside gold.
